What you will do

As a Head of Outbound Logistics Engineering within Supply Chain, you will be responsible to manage the team driving network optimization initiatives from idea generation to implementation to achieve the most optimized distribution from a cost, service, and sustainability perspective. Including:

• Setting ambitious performance targets for the cost and performance of vehicle transport and logistics at mid-term and budget horizon

• Build, with the team, a logistics strategy able to reach the targets validated short and long term.

• Conduct analysis of sales demographics, cost, lead time and CO2 and propose recommendation forward connected to sourcing’s.

• Analyze and improve processes and way of working within the engineering teams, regionally as well as globally.

• Calculate OBL cost input estimates into future car programs in early phase and implement new car models in the industrialization phase.

• Develop the Outbound Engineering team with a strong focus on change management, increasing curiosity and skills development.

The key is to establish and leverage strong collaboration with internal and external stakeholders. This function is critical in the success of managing the finished vehicle distribution, and in assuring that vehicles are delivered to customers on time, every time, and with good quality.
